Job Description
The primary function of this role is to supervise and support residents in their daily routines while maintaining a safe, therapeutic environment. You will assist youth in reaching treatment goals, facilitate activities and groups, and provide consistent mentorship. This role also includes documentation, behavior management, and collaboration with the clinical and administrative teams.
Essential Duties
- Provide direct supervision and maintain client safety at all times
- Build positive rapport and model appropriate behavior and communication
- Mentor and assist clients in meeting their treatment and daily goals
- Facilitate and participate in daily activities, chores, meals, and group sessions
- Document daily observations, progress notes, and behavioral reports accurately
- Provide transportation for clients to appointments or community outings using company vehicles
- Enforce house rules and maintain structure in alignment with company policies
- Identify and report behavioral concerns, safety risks, or incidents promptly
- Maintain compliance with all required trainings, certifications, and documentation standards
